My thoughts are that "CHICAGO" is all wrong. I have never seen it so condensed before. I took a look at a handful of photos and the "O" in Chicago extends beyond the "21" in every case. This jersey has the "O" finishing way before the "21" does.

I have never seen a Cubs strip tags like that before. The strip tags numbers are usually sewn on. But Rob would now for sure.


Russell never used "sewn" (embroidered) numbers on the strip tag in the collar. They incorporated screened black uniform #/set/year information on a paper type tag.

Both Wilson and Majestic incorporated embroidered numbers on the knit material strip tagging. Wilson also included a small year tag in the tail.
